Understanding the Root Causes
The current energy crisis is not a new phenomenon in Ghana, but this latest episode appears to be more severe and widespread. A primary contributor is the aging electricity infrastructure, which has not received adequate investment in maintenance and upgrades over the years. This results in frequent breakdowns and inefficiencies in transmission and distribution. Furthermore, despite efforts to diversify Ghana’s energy sources, the country remains heavily reliant on hydroelectric power, making it vulnerable to droughts and fluctuating water levels in the Akosombo Dam.
Adding to the challenge is the increasing demand for electricity driven by rapid population growth and economic development. Without a corresponding increase in generation capacity, the power supply struggles to keep up. Issues with fuel supply for thermal power plants have also been cited, creating further instability. Experts suggest a lack of long-term planning, poor management, and corruption within the energy sector have exacerbated the situation.
The Role of the Akosombo Dam
The Akosombo Dam, a crucial source of hydroelectric power for Ghana, is currently operating below optimal capacity due to low water levels caused by prolonged drought conditions. This has significantly reduced the amount of electricity generated, contributing to the power deficit. Furthermore, there are concerns about the structural integrity of the dam itself, which has not undergone significant rehabilitation in decades. Addressing these issues is critical for ensuring a sustainable energy supply.
The impact on the lake’s ecosystem is also significant. Reduced water levels affect fish populations and the livelihoods of communities dependent on fishing. Additionally, the dam’s operations impact downstream agricultural activities and water access for communities relying on the Volta River. Balancing the need for electricity generation with environmental and social concerns is a complex challenge that requires careful consideration.
Challenges with Thermal Power Generation
While hydroelectric power remains dominant, thermal power plants play a vital role in complementing the energy supply. However, these plants often face challenges related to fuel procurement, particularly natural gas. Delays in gas supply from sources like Nigeria can disrupt operations and lead to power shortages. The high cost of importing fuel also adds to the financial burdens faced by the electricity provider, making it difficult to invest in infrastructure upgrades.
Moreover, the efficiency of some thermal plants is questionable, with older facilities producing more emissions and requiring more fuel to generate the same amount of electricity. Modernizing these plants and exploring alternative fuel sources are essential for reducing costs and improving environmental performance. Investing in renewable energy sources like solar and wind power offers a long-term solution for diversifying the energy mix and reducing reliance on fossil fuels.

The Impact on Businesses and the Economy
The recurring power outages inflict significant damage on businesses across various sectors. Manufacturing companies face production disruptions, leading to reduced output and lost revenue. Small and medium-sized enterprises (SMEs), which are the backbone of the Ghanaian economy, are particularly vulnerable, as they often lack the resources to invest in backup power systems. The cost of operating generators adds to business expenses, impacting profitability and competitiveness.
The energy crisis also discourages foreign investment, as investors are wary of the unreliable power supply. This hampers economic growth and job creation. To mitigate the impact on businesses, the government needs to prioritize the restoration of a stable and affordable energy supply, as well as provide support to businesses to help them invest in energy efficiency measures and backup power systems.
